> Justin Hunt said:
> > Well.. i am close... except for the part that myth crashes now when i
> > watch tv... i have it auto logging into kde, after that point, i put a
> > file called start into the .kde/Autostart folder it contains
> > #!/bin/bash
> > /usr/local/bin/mythbackend &
> > /usr/local/bin/mythfrontend
> >
> > after i chmod+x that file and it starts it... but now for some reason
> > myth freaks when i hit watch tv... ... ill keep you posted if i get it
> > to wokr... gonna try and redirect its output somehow...
> >
> Do something like this:
>
> /usr/local/bin/mythfrontend > ~/mythfrontend.log 2>&1
>
> After checking my redirect file, I got this:
>
> QSqlDatabase warning: QMYSQL3 driver not loaded
> QSqlDatabase: available drivers:
> QSqlDatabase warning: QMYSQL3 driver not loaded
> QSqlDatabase: available drivers:
> Unable to open database:
> Driver error was:
> Driver not loaded
> Database error was:
> Driver not loaded
>
> NOW, using the excellent searchable archives at
> http://www.gossamer-threads.com/perl/mailarc/gforum.cgi, I got some more
> information that got me on the right path. The thread that helped me is:
>
http://www.gossamer-threads.com/perl/mailarc/gforum.cgi?post=50174;search_string=QSqlDatabase%20warning%3A%20QMYSQL3%20driver%20not%20loaded;guest=526270&t=search_engine#50174
>
> Anyway, seems I need to add "export QTDIR=/usr/lib/qt3" at the top of your
> script! I also need to put a "sleep 10" after launching mythbackend and
> before mythfrontend.
>
> Works great now :)
